Exercise In the following sentences, change the position of the information of time (highlighted in blue). If the information of time is at the beginning of the sentence, put it in the middle. If the information of time is in the middle of the sentence, put it up front. While doing so, remember the rules about the word order in a sentence with an information of time. Example: Um viertel nach acht wäscht mein Bruder die Wäsche. Mein Bruder wäscht um viertel nach acht die Wäsche. OR: Mein Bruder wäscht die Wäsche um viertel nach acht.
For the next exercise: Remember that when you use reflexive verbs and the information of time is in the middle of the sentence, you have to put the information of time behind the reflexive pronoun.
